Student Research Journals

The journals presented here offer examples of student research and reflective practice developed throughout my ceramics courses. More than sketchbooks or process notes, these journals document sustained observation, material experimentation, historical and contemporary research, technical investigation, design development, and critical reflection. They demonstrate how students connect making with reading, writing, and inquiry, revealing the evolution of ideas alongside the development of their ceramic work.​​

The journals included here are representative examples selected with students' permission.
